zoukankan      html  css  js  c++  java
  • Linux物理网卡聚合及桥接

    说明:

    (1)、在网卡聚合绑定之前,要先停用NetworkManager服务(或者在网卡中添加参数:NM_CONTROLLED=no),否则系统重启后绑定的IP失效了。

    # systemctl stop NetworkManager
    # systemctl disable NetworkManager
    

    (2)、网卡桥接服务器需要依赖KVM虚拟化相关服务:

    # vim /etc/yum.repos.d/opennebula.repo
    

        添加如下内容:
        [opennebula]
        name=opennebula
        baseurl=http://downloads.opennebula.org/repo/5.0/CentOS/7/x86_64
        enabled=1
        gpgcheck=0

    # yum install opennebula-node-kvm

    准备工作完成后,就可以正式开始了!

    1、编辑物理网卡配置文件:

    # vim ifcfg-eno1
    

    DEVICE=eno1
    TYPE=Ethernet
    BOOTPROTO=none
    NM_CONTROLLED=no
    ONBOOT=yes
    MASTER=bond0
    SLAVE=yes

    # vim ifcfg-ens15f0

    DEVICE=ens15f0
    TYPE=Ethernet
    BOOTPROTO=none
    NM_CONTROLLED=no
    ONBOOT=yes
    MASTER=bond0
    SLAVE=yes

    2、创建聚合网卡配置文件:

    # vim ifcfg-bond0
    

    DEVICE=bond0
    TYPE=bond
    BOOTPROTO=none
    NM_CONTROLLED=no
    ONBOOT=yes
    BRIDGE=br0

    3、创建桥接网卡配置文件:

    # vim ifcfg-br0
    

    DEVICE=br0
    TYPE=Bridge
    BOOTPROTO=none
    ONBOOT=yes
    NM_CONTROLLED=no
    IPADDR=192.168.1.233
    NETMASK=255.255.255.0
    GATEWAY=192.168.1.1

    4、编辑网卡聚服务配置文件:

    # vim /etc/modprobe.d/bonding.conf
    

    alias bond0 bonding
    options bonding mode=4 miimon=100

    5、执行网卡聚合命令:

    # modprobe bonding
    

    6、查看聚合网卡的状态:

    # cat /proc/net/bonding/bond0
    

    [THE END]

  • 相关阅读:
    第六次学习笔记
    第四篇笔记
    第三篇学习笔记
    第二篇学习笔记
    第一篇学习笔记
    px与dp、sp之间的转换
    SQLite的使用(二):数据增删改查
    Logcat的级别以及Logcat的调试使用
    Android 创建服务(一)
    简说SQLite
  • 原文地址:https://www.cnblogs.com/configure/p/11492385.html
Copyright © 2011-2022 走看看